Donald Nally, conductor of the Crossing and David Lang, composer and University of Iowa alum, will be in conversation moderated by Ann Howard Jones (BM ‘64, MM 66’, DMA ‘84) as part of the Creative Matters lecture series.

The Crossing and the UI choir Kantorei will perform together at the top of concert and music director Donald Nally will lead The Crossing in performance of Lang’s poor hymnal.
